Next, … san bernardino ca property appraiserWeb5 de dic. de 2024 · Using a sponge and bowl of distilled water, dampen the sponge and wipe down the interior of your humidor. 2. Then saturate the sponge with distilled water to the point that it’s heavy, but not dripping. 3. Lay a piece of plastic, like a sandwich bag, in the middle of the humidor and put the sponge on top. san bernardino ca public court record access
